Now here’s a sight you don’t see very often. And I must admit when I first saw them I thought I must have been drunk. But seeing pink elephants this time wasn’t due to any over indulgence with alcohol, but a new exhibition of various multi coloured Asian elephants dotted around London. In parks, famous locations and tourist attractions The idea is to highlight the plight of the Asian elephant. The elephants have all been decorated by various artists and fashion designers including Julian MacDonald, Alice Temperley, Louise Von Furstenberg, Tommy Hilfiger, John Rocha and many others.
It certainly brightens up London and all in a very good cause. Let’s hope it works I’ll certainly be giving my support, besides I’ve seen enough pink elephants in my time.
